Anigre (a-knee-gray)
is a light and tan heart-wood which has a fairly straight
grain. Commonly found with a "wave" like appearance
running through the grain offering a unique luster. If
left unfinished, Anigre has a cedar-like scent that appeals
to many.
This uncommon
wood species has a medium-to-coarse texture, but in heavier
grades has a fine texture.
Anigre offers
a superior polish over common wood species and is perfect
for cabinetry and other fine furniture.
